The site is superb and private, yet close to the village, mature, and with the river Avon in front of the current cottage and the proposed new house. The location is ideal for seeing nature at its best.

The proposed property, designed by renowned local architects Hawkes Edwards, benefits from a wealth of ground floor reception space, all dual or triple aspect, with the hall, living room and kitchen/dining room opening on to the expansive breakfast deck overlooking the river.

The spacious bedrooms include a substantial principal suite with a private first-floor sitting room. The first-floor accommodation could be remodelled to provide additional bedrooms if desired.

The generous triple garage and workshop are ideal for the car enthusiast, and the office space above could be available for a variety of alternative uses to suit the buyer.

The property would sit well within its own gardens and grounds with a selection of mature trees and shrubs, in all the plot totals around 1.6 acres. The river frontage is lovely, with a boat jetty.

Access is along a long private driveway, the first part of which is a right of way and shared with Willowmere, with additional visitor parking in front of the house.

More information regarding the detailed outline planning consent, approved design and plans can be found on the Stratford-upon-Avon District Council's planning portal under the reference number 22/03316/OUT granted on 24th April 2023 and consent for the establishment of the residential garden amenity for Boat Cottage was granted reference 22/01206/LDE.


The site with consent for a superb detached riverside house is situated in a secluded position down a long drive off Duck Lane in the much sought-after Warwickshire village of Welford-on-Avon, which lies about six miles southwest of Stratford-upon-Avon. The village has an excellent active community with a fine parish church, several public houses, a general store, a butcher shop and a garage.

Nearby Stratford-upon-Avon is the region's cultural centre and is famed for its theatres and Shakespearean heritage. The town also offers an abundance of shops, restaurants, public houses, and a wide range of entertainment and sports facilities.

There is a primary school in Welford-on-Avon with a superb reputation and an excellent range of state, private and grammar schools in the area to suit most requirements. The property is exceptionally well located for The Croft Prep School, Stratford Grammar schools, Alcester grammar school, and the Warwick schools are also within easy reach.

Birmingham International Airport is about 28 miles away, and intercity trains run from Warwick Parkway Station to London Marylebone and from Coventry to London Euston.

Racing is at Stratford-upon-Avon, Warwick and Cheltenham, and several golf courses are in the area, including Welford-on-Avon, Bidford-on-Avon and Stratford-upon-Avon.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
